Global Premieres and Star-Studed Dramas

The international slate is particularly strong this week. Leading the charge is "Idol I," a South Korean legal thriller series that arrives on Netflix from December 22, 2025. The show, written by Kim Da-rin and directed by Lee Kwang-young, features Kim Jae-young and Choi Soo-young. It follows defence lawyer Maeng Se-na as she defends her favourite idol, Do Ra-ik, accused of murder, only to discover disturbing truths.

Meanwhile, JioHotstar is set to stream "Amadeus" from December 22. This fictionalised retelling of composers Mozart and Salieri stars Will Sharpe and Paul Bettany, with Gabrielle Creevy as Constanze Mozart. The series, which premieres on Sky Atlantic on December 21, delves into 18th-century Vienna, exploring Mozart's prodigious rise and his intense rivalry with the court composer.

Festive Fare and Long-Awaited Finales

Netflix adds a touch of holiday spirit with "Goodbye June," premiering on December 24. This Christmas family drama marks the directorial debut of Kate Winslet, who also stars alongside a stellar cast including Toni Collette, Helen Mirren, and Timothy Spall. The story, penned by Winslet's son Joe Anders, revolves around a family reconciling around their dying mother during the festive season.

However, the most awaited event for many is the conclusion of a global phenomenon. "Stranger Things Season 5 Volume 2" hits Netflix on December 26, 2025. This release continues the final season's three-part rollout, with the last episodes of the Duffer Brothers' iconic sci-fi horror series scheduled to drop on December 31, bringing the epic saga to a close.

Indian Debuts and Spy Thrillers

For fans of Indian cinema, ZEE5 will host the OTT debut of the Hindi romantic drama "Ek Deewane Ki Deewaniyat" from December 26. Directed by Milap Zaveri and starring Harshvardhan Rane and Sonam Bajwa, the film, which released theatrically during Diwali 2025, became a commercial success despite mixed reviews.

Rounding off the week is an intriguing spy thriller. JioHotstar will stream "The Copenhagen Test" from December 28. This American sci-fi espionage series, created by Thomas Brandon and executive produced by James Wan, features Simu Liu and Melissa Barrera. The eight-episode show promises a blend of futuristic themes and classic spy action.
